Official abstract text for this publication.
An aqueous-based coating composition suitable as a container coating comprising: (A) a resinous phase comprising (i) an at least partially neutralized acid functional polymer containing reactive functional groups, (ii) a phenolic compound and an aldehyde or the reaction product thereof, (iii) a hydroxy-terminated polybutadiene; the resinous phase dispersed in (B) aqueous medium.

What is claimed is: 1. An aqueous-based coating composition comprising: (A) a resinous phase of (i) 20 to 35 percent by weight of an at least partially neutralized acid functional polymer containing reactive functional groups, (ii) 40 to 60 percent by weight of a phenolic compound and an aldehyde or the reaction product thereof, (iii) 2.5 to 10 percent by weight of a hydroxy-terminated polybutadiene; the resinous phase dispersed in (B) aqueous medium. 2. The aqueous-based coating composition of claim 1 in which the phenolic compound is selected from the group consisting of phenol and an alkylated phenol. 3. The aqueous-based coating composition of claim 1 in which the aldehyde is formaldehyde. 4. The aqueous-based coating composition of claim 1 in which the acid functional polymer is a copolymer of (meth)acrylic monomers. 5. The aqueous-based coating composition of claim 1 in which the acid functional polymer comprises carboxylic acid groups. 6. The aqueous-based coating composition of claim 1 in which the reactive functional groups are selected from hydroxyl and N-alkoxymethyl groups. 7. The aqueous-based coating composition of claim 1 containing an amine-terminated polyamide in the resinous phase. 8. The aqueous-based coating composition of claim 1 containing an alkyl-phenyl silsesquioxane resin in the resinous phase. 9. A coated article comprising: (A) a substrate and (B) a coating deposited on at least a portion of the substrate from the composition of claim 1 . 10. The coated article of claim 9 in which the substrate is a container. 11. The coated article of claim 10 in which the container is a food or beverage container. 12. The coated article of claim 11 in which the coating is on the interior surface of the container.
